Great podcast on Latino Rebels: “The Kids Who Got the ‘Mexican Repatriation’ of the 1930s into California Textbook”
“Over the weekend, NPR’s Latino USA broadcast a fantastic audio story that chronicled how a group of California elementary school students from Bell Gardens worked to get the often-overlooked story of “The Mexican Repatriation” into the state’s public school curriculum.
